boy.. if only someone could've seen this coming (from 8/1/2022):

not only does FOX control BTN, it also sits alongside the B1G at media negotiations:

"In an unusual setup, Fox Sports President Mark Silverman and Fox Sports executive vice president Larry Jones join Warren and Big Ten senior associate commissioner Kerry Kenny in all Big Ten negotiations with multiple networks and streaming services."

so, FOX is going around asking its competitors for money for 2nd and 3rd tier B1G games
